KB11280: "Object name is too long.” error message appears when attempting to drill on a report in MicroStrategy Developer 10.x.


Stefan Zepeda

Salesforce Solutions Architect • Strategy


This tech note helps to solve the issue that may occur when attempting to drill down on an attribute or a metric

SYMPTOM:
When attempting to drill down on an attribute or a metric, users may receive the following error message:

ka02R000000kcj7QAA_0EM440000002Fmb.jpeg

Object name is too long.
CAUSE:
This error is encountered because the new report name being generated has reached the character limit. Any object in Strategy, including reports, filters, metrics, etc., can only have a name that is 255 characters or less in length.
When drilling in a report, a new report is created with the drilled-to level being appended to the previous report's name, thus constantly increasing the length of the report name each time it is drilled. So, if a user drills from "Sample Report" down to the Customer attribute, the new report will be named "Sample Report > Customer."
